Basic Information
| Product Name | Ethyl 4-(2-Bromo-4-Fluorophenyl)-6-Methyl-2-(Thiazol-2-Yl)-1,4-Dihydropyrimidine-5-Carboxylate |
| CAS No. | 1092952-98-1 |
| Molecular Formula | C₁₇H₁₅BrFN₃O₂S |
| Molecular Weight | 424.29 g/mol |
| Synonyms | 4-(2-Bromo-4-fluorophenyl)-6-methyl-2-(1,3-thiazol-2-yl)-1,4-dihydropyrimidine-5-carboxylic acid ethyl ester; Ethyl 4-(2-bromo-4-fluorophenyl)-6-methyl-2-(1,3-thiazol-2-yl)-1,4-dihydropyrimidine-5-carboxylate; 1,4-Dihydropyrimidine-5-carboxylic acid, 4-(2-bromo-4-fluorophenyl)-6-methyl-2-(2-thiazolyl)-, ethyl ester; 1092952-98-1; DHPM-thiazole derivative; Bromo-fluoro dihydropyrimidine-thiazole intermediate. |

Storage
Preserve in a tightly closed container, protected from light. Store in a cool, dry place at a controlled room temperature (15-25°C). This product is hygroscopic (moisture-sensitive) and light-sensitive; therefore, containers must be kept tightly sealed in a dry environment and away from direct light exposure to maintain stability and purity.
